Transaction 44aec4edebd0a2b8a553eca79071285f31c56480d3877a983b35bcffb0da6539
1 Input
2 Outputs
- 44aec4edebd0a2b8a553eca79071285f31c56480d3877a983b35bcffb0da6539:0
- 44aec4edebd0a2b8a553eca79071285f31c56480d3877a983b35bcffb0da6539:1
value 67593481
address 1PaVDY2oeMCpXkuBTgCVdCwiK5KEHBHA72
value 459994
address 33H84KXJrhCgq9uVAJchnhnHVsNGtkBiHf